Title:
Performance of SAP ERP with Memory Virtualization using IBM Active Memory Expansion as an example
Abstract:
Main memory virtualization is used to expand the effective main memory capacity. IBM offers main memory virtualization called Active Memory Expansion on its POWER platform. By using this technique, an existing main memory area can be expanded meaning that more main memory is represented to guest operating systems than physical memory is actually available.
